This is incorrect.
Quote:[color=#ffff33]5.7 A player who was killed in a PvP fight must not enter the system where the fight took place with any of the characters on his/her account(s) until two hours have passed from the time of his/her destruction.
If the player respawns in the same system, he/she must leave the system within 10 minutes of his destruction without attacking anyone, except in self-defense. Other players are not allowed to attack one who is leaving.
Transports/Freighters/Liners which have been killed in a PvP fight may return to the system in which they were destroyed but only for purposes of moving through the system or for trade within that system. They may only act in a purely defensive manner and may not resume acts of piracy.
5.8 A player who was killed in a PvP fight must not attack the enemy (player or players involved in the death) with any of the characters on his/her account(s) for 2 hours.
5.9 Self-killing during a PvP fight is counted as a normal PvP death.
Y'all need to pay attention when the rules change. You die - you stay OUT of the system with ALL of your characters (that aren't traders that are trading).
